About the Role:
The purpose of the position is to manage Water Services Trade Waste and Backflow Prevention regulatory functions to ensure compliance with Council’s policies and legislative requirements. The position is actively involved in the development, review & implementation of relevant policies & procedures, issuing approvals and agreements; and inspecting and monitoring sites as per the implementation program.
The position will liaise and collaborate with internal and external stakeholders and interacts with community members.

About Us
Wingecarribee Shire Council is in the magnificent Southern Highlands with a balance of pristine natural scenery and rich diversity of lifestyle choices from its historical past to modern amenities, all at your doorstep. With a population of over 50,000, Wingecarribee Shire has much to offer both the individual and family alike. Only 110 km from Sydney CBD and 70 km from Wollongong, we are a relatively easy traverse for those wishing to commute to the Shire and, equally so, for those who prefer to live in the Shire whilst enjoying an occasional jaunt to the City or Coast.

Essential Criteria:
1. Certificate III in Water Industry Operations (Trade Waste) or equivalent with a minimum of 12 months experience in Trade Waste or Water industry, demonstrating an understanding of relevant legislations.
2. Demonstrated experience and technical competence in liquid trade waste and backflow prevention processes and procedures including inspection and monitoring of liquid trade wasteand backflow prevention sites and collection of wastewater samples.
3. Demonstrated ability in the use of computer applications, and operating devices effectively, embracing digital solutions for works activities to enable productivity facilitate day- to-day operations.
4. Ability to network effectively with key stakeholders in offering advice and support to delivering operational and maintenance services.
5. Hold a C Class drivers licence and WHS Induction card.
